What they do
An Athletic Trainer treats injuries and provides training to minimize the risk of injury for athletes and people playing sports. Responds when an athlete is injured on the field. Works for schools or colleges, for professional sports teams, or in physicians' offices.

Responsibilities The Athletic Trainer provides care to clients in need of sports related rehabilitation services in various settings. This person is responsible for the care of injured athletes from adolescents to geriatrics at community sporting events and on the practice and playing fields. The Athletic Trainer administers immediate first aid and develops a treatment program based on the nature of the injury. The Athletic Trainer communicates with the injured athlete, physician, coach, and family as appropriate.
